Deal Abstract

Innovation in the cycling backpack/apparel market. Founder has bootstrapped a lifestyle brand and raising capital to grow.

Financials

  1. Fundraising Target? $250000
  2. Fundraised So Far? $40537
  3. Pre-Money Valuation? $3500000
  4. Previous Year’s Annual Revenue: $217841
  5. Previous Year’s Annual Net Income (+ Profitable, — Burning Cash): $-43009

Six Calacanis Criteria

  1. A startup that is based in SV? False, New York, NY
  2. Has at least 2 founders? False, One founder who owns 94% of stock
  3. Has product in the market? True, Revenue generating
  4. 6 months of continuous user growth or 6 months of revenue? False, Revenue decreased from 2018 to 2019
  5. Notable investors? False, Bootstrapped
  6. Post-funding, will have 18 months of runway? True, $43k annual burn, at 18 months would be ~$75k

Seven Thiel Tests

  1. Engineering? 2, Unique bicycle backpack innovation, as a cyclist, I wonder how this plays with bikeshare
  2. Timing? 1, Cycling should increase but uncertain if venture backable
  3. Monopoly? 1, Don’t know anyone with one of these bags
  4. People? 3, Good people to be building this product
  5. Distribution? 3, Seem to have really figured out distribution
  6. Durability? 2, Lifestyle brand, fairly defensible
  7. Secret? 2, The population of city commuting cyclist is about to boom in venture style

What Has to Go Right

  1. Partner with bikeshares at some point; 2. Enter into cyclist apparel and other accessories; 3. Keep innovating new products

What Could Go Wrong

  1. Mass market vs high end product; 2. Revenue did not increase 2018 to 2019, concerned if this remains the case; 3. Cycling remains a niche market and doesn’t go mainstream
